Anesthesia Machines

One of the most critical pieces of equipment for CRNAs in hospital settings is the anesthesia machine. Anesthesia machines are used to deliver a precise mixture of gases and vapors to patients to induce and maintain anesthesia during surgical procedures. These machines are equipped with controls for oxygen flow, vaporizers for volatile anesthetics, and monitoring devices to track patient vital signs. Anesthesia machines also have safety features to ensure the safe delivery of anesthesia and to protect patients from over or under anesthesia.

Monitoring Devices

Monitoring devices are essential for CRNAs to assess and track the patient's vital signs during anesthesia administration. These devices include pulse oximeters to measure oxygen saturation in the blood, ECG monitors to track heart rate and rhythm, non-invasive blood pressure monitors, capnography monitors to measure end-tidal carbon dioxide levels, and temperature monitors. Continuous monitoring of these vital signs is crucial for detecting any changes in the patient's condition and adjusting the anesthesia accordingly to ensure patient safety.

Airway Management Tools

CRNAs are responsible for managing the patient's airway to ensure proper oxygenation and ventilation during anesthesia. Airway management tools such as laryngoscopes, endotracheal tubes, supraglottic airway devices, and suction devices are essential for CRNAs to secure the patient's airway and maintain proper airflow to the lungs. Proper airway management is critical for preventing hypoxia, hypercapnia, and other complications related to anesthesia administration.

IV Supplies

Intravenous (IV) supplies are necessary for CRNAs to administer medications, fluids, and blood products to patients during anesthesia. IV catheters, IV tubing, syringes, and infusion pumps are essential tools for delivering anesthesia medications and maintaining the patient's hydration and hemodynamic status. CRNAs must have a thorough understanding of IV therapy principles and practices to ensure safe and effective administration of medications through the IV route.

Medications

CRNAs have access to a variety of medications that are used during anesthesia to induce sedation, analgesia, muscle relaxation, and anesthesia. These medications include induction agents, opioids, neuromuscular blocking agents, local anesthetics, and reversal agents. CRNAs must be knowledgeable about the pharmacology, dosing, side effects, and contraindications of these medications to ensure safe and appropriate administration to patients. Proper documentation and monitoring of medication administration are also essential to prevent medication errors and adverse drug reactions.

Supply and Equipment Management

Effective management of equipment and supplies is crucial for CRNAs to deliver safe and efficient anesthesia care in hospital settings. Proper inventory control, storage, and maintenance of equipment and supplies are essential to ensure that CRNAs have access to the necessary tools and resources to perform their duties effectively. CRNAs must also adhere to infection control protocols, safety guidelines, and regulatory requirements related to the use of equipment and supplies to maintain a safe and sterile anesthesia environment.

Best Practices for Equipment and Supply Management

  1. Implementing a standardized inventory management system to track equipment and supplies usage, expiration dates, and reordering needs.
  2. Regularly inspecting and maintaining equipment to ensure proper functioning and compliance with manufacturer specifications.
  3. Training staff on proper equipment and supply usage, storage, and disposal procedures to prevent contamination and ensure patient safety.
